Promoting Climate-Sensitive Early Childhood Care and Education in Emergencies Year of publication: 2023 Corporate author: Inter-agency Network for Education in Emergencies (INEE) This brief addresses a gap in climate change and education literature: young children who are affected by crises. Climate mitigation and adaptation efforts often exclude early childhood care and education (ECCE), especially in crises and emergencies. Therefore, the brief outlines multisectoral ECCE interventions that can serve as solutions to broader climate change mitigation and adaptation goals. These interventions look at long-term solutions that reduce childrenโs exposure to climate change risks. The aim of these long-term solutions is to create new climate-adapted ways of thinking, being, and doing by focusing on care โ for each other and for the earth โ and by building climate resilience among children and their supporting care systems.
Students Protesting for Climate Protection Year of publication: 2019 Corporate author: DW Channel Climate change from global warming and sea levels has become a preoccupation for many, especially young people. The 16-year-old Swedish environmental activist Greta Thunberg became famous for her activism against climate pollution and her impact was transmitted to German youth, and the goal is to influence politicians for a better future for them. And for the world. The video shows a documentary produced by DW about a protest stand by students about what is happening regarding climate change.
